Shark Week...

There are big fish that lurk in the vast ocean
and evil men that mimic their movements and characteristics,
upon the earth,

The fish seek and destroy to live and to do their part
in the cycle of life, but the land sharks seek and destroy
because of greed, envy and hate,

The fish is not evil by any means
man cannot say the same,

Sharks of the sea are put in the ocean for several purposes
as are the the land sharks, but in my opinion only one of these
sharks completely understands their purposes and I'm positive
it isn't the sharks that walk the earth,

Ocean sharks kill for the purpose of living themselves
land sharks again cannot say the same,

Sharks of the sea Are Not Evil!
Man is most definitely evil,
so save a shark and pray for man...
